Should the pool pump be covered in winter?

Our region has temperatures that regularly fall below freezing. Pool filters must be winterized in order to prevent cracking from freezing water. While a cover won't prevent the filter from freezing or protect it from oxidization, it will help to keep the exterior of the filter protected.

Are you able to pump the pool while you swim?

The pump doesn't have to be on 24/7. However, it is recommended that pool water be filtered at least once every 24 hours. You may need to run your pump up to eight hours per days if the pool is used constantly.
